All iPhone 16 Models Feature Qualcomm's Custom SDX71M Modem, Possibly a Counterpart to the X75

IT Home, Sept. 21 - According to teardown analysis by TechInsights, all models of the iPhone 16 utilize Qualcomm's SDX71M modem. However, information regarding this specific model remains scarce. Considering that the iPhone 16 boasts an average 22-23% increase in both upload and download speeds, a feat unlikely for a contemporary product, the SDX71M is highly suspected to be a customized X75 counterpart developed specifically for Apple by Qualcomm.

 All iPhone 16 Models Feature Qualcomm

It's noteworthy that the previous generation iPhone 15 Pro Max supported TD-LTE B46 band, which the X71M lacks, and the reason behind this omission is currently unclear.

This discovery has sparked debate within the industry, with many speculating that Apple may have reached a new partnership agreement with Qualcomm to secure a more powerful baseband chip. This could also imply that Apple will continue using Qualcomm's baseband chips in the future, rather than developing their own.

Of course, this information is currently speculative, and definitive answers await official confirmation.
